Bruno Lage may face a significant double setback for the Benfica - Santa Clara match. After the international commitments, Nicolás Otamendi and Richard Ríos remain doubtful for the clash in the fifth round of the Liga Portugal Betclic, which will be played this Friday, September 12, at 8:15 PM, at Estádio da Luz.
"Tomorrow morning we will assess the players who arrived yesterday [Wednesday], many players are only on their third day of preparation," stated Bruno Lage when asked about the presence of Nicolás Otamendi and Richard Ríos in the Benfica – Santa Clara match, of the fifth round of the Liga Portugal Betclic.
The Argentine international – who made some statements that caused controversy in Portugal – was sent off at the 31st minute of the match against Ecuador and is expected to be fresher than the midfielder. Meanwhile, Richard Ríos, playing for Colombia, completed the full 90 minutes and accumulated more fatigue.
"Santa Clara is a very organized team, last year we faced them three times, they know what they have and like to do with the ball. We know how they defend and like to press. It will be a very demanding game on our part. We have to play at the highest level," concluded Bruno Lage, warning of the difficulties Benfica will encounter.
The Benfica – Santa Clara match is scheduled for September 12, at 8:15 PM, at Estádio da Luz, and pertains to the fifth round of the Liga Portugal Betclic. Bruno Lage's team is in fourth place in the National Championship, with nine points in three matches. Porto is first (12 points in four matches), Famalicão second (10 points in four games), and Sporting third (nine points in four matches).
